Overview

Dr Asif Zaman (Principal Lecturer) is the current Head of the Department of the Accounting Economics and Finance department.

He holds an M.B.A. from the University of Wales, Institute Cardiff (UWIC), and a PhD in Islamic Banking and Finance from Cardiff Metropolitan University.

Dr Asif Zaman has the following professional body associations:

  • Fellow of the Higher Education Authority (FHEA)
  • FHEA since (2011)
  • Academic Fellow of The Association of International Accountants FAIA(ACAD) since April 2015

CMBE (Certified Management and Business Educator) By CABS (Chartered Association of Business Schools) since March 2020

Chartered Institute of Management Accountants (CIMA) (CIMA - Candidate), Since 2017

His expertise lies in Islamic Banking and Finance, Corporate Finance and Accounting and sustainable finance.

Before joining Cardiff Metropolitan University in 2010, he worked for several years in the United Arab Emirates (U.A.E.). He joined as a director of human resources and, after a year, switched his role to a full-time academic teaching faculty within the Business and Management department.
